2. Understand the Feature Request
Read and analyze the feature description provided by the user. Consider:
- •What is the core functionality being requested?
- •How does it relate to existing systems in the codebase?
- •What are potential technical approaches?
- •What information is missing or ambiguous?
3. Ask Clarifying Questions
Before writing the plan, ask the user clarifying questions to ensure the plan is accurate and complete. Questions should cover:
Functional Requirements:
- •What specific user actions trigger this feature?
- •What are the expected outcomes/results?
- •Are there edge cases to consider?
- •How should errors or invalid states be handled?
Integration:
- •How does this interact with existing game systems?
- •Are there dependencies on other features?
- •What existing code patterns should be followed?
Scope:
- •What is in scope vs out of scope for this feature?
- •Are there optional enhancements vs required functionality?
- •What is the priority order if there are multiple components?
Technical Considerations:
- •Are there performance constraints?
- •Are there specific UI/UX requirements?
- •Should this be data-driven (JSON) or code-driven?
Wait for the user to answer these questions before proceeding.
